A new tripodal ligand containing ferrocenyl and hydrazone groups was synthesized by the condensation of ferrocenylcarbonylhydrazine with tris {[2 (2 formylphenyl)oxo]ethyl}amine and characterized by elemental analyses, IR and 1H NMR. It is expected to be an important ligand to react with transition metals to give functional coordination complexes with interesting physical chemical properties. Studies on its reactions and properties are in progress.
